想要使用 YAML 作为属性配置文件(以 .yml 或 .yaml 结尾),需要将 SnakeYAML 库添加到 classpath 下,Spring Boot 中的 spring-boot-starter-web 或 spring-boot-starter 都对 SnakeYAML 库做了集成, 只要项目中引用了这两个 Starter 中的任何一个,Spring Boot 会自动添加 SnakeYAML 库到 classpath 下。下面是...
接口地址:/booksManageBoot/borrow/add 请求方式:POST consumes:["application/json"] produces:["*/*"] 请求示例: { "bookId": 0, "createTime": "", "endTime": "", "id": 0, "ret": 0, "updateTime": "", "userId": 0 } 请求参数: 参数名称参数说明in是否必须数据类型schema borrow borro...
如此表述的方式更容易系统地掌握 Spring Boot 以及 Spring Framework 的核心特性。如果从特性的发展历程来观察,它则属于编年体,如 Spring Framework 注解驱动编程模型从 1.x 到 5.0 中的发展与 Spring Boot 自动装配之间的关联,以及 Spring Boot 1.0 到 1.4 的外部化配置源是怎样利用 Spring Environment 抽象逐步完善...
1、Add Configuration...-->点击“+”-->Spring Boot 2、填写/选择如下信息-->保存 3、运行程序 5.7、访问项目及接口文档 项目登录用户如下图: 浏览器地址栏输入:http://127.0.0.1:8080/booksManageBoot 管理员身份登录 普通用户身份登录 浏览器地址栏输入:http://127.0.0.1:8080/booksManageBoot/doc.html ...
推荐《Spring Boot源码解读与原理分析》 基于SpringBoot2.3.11.RELEASE版本对源码进行解读,提供测试代码以及课件,深入剖析SpringBoot的核心源码运行机制。 从底层读懂Spring Boot源码和原理这一本书就够了。 Spring Boot是目前Java EE开发中颇受欢迎的框架之一。依托于底层Spring Framework的基础支撑,以及完善强大的特性设...
2023-10-10 246 发布于黑龙江 版权 简介: Spring Boot 学习研究笔记(九) - Spring Data JPA常用注解 8、@MapKey 在一对多,多对多关系中,我们可以用Map来保存集合对象。默认用主键值做key,如果使用复合主键,则用id class的实例做key,如果指定了name属性,就用指定的field的值做key。 元数据属性说明: name: ...
Spring Boot中的 6 种API请求参数读取方式 使用Spring Boot开发API的时候,读取请求参数是服务端编码中最基本的一项操作,Spring Boot中也提供了多种机制来满足不同的API设计要求。 接下来,就通过本文,为大家总结6种常用的请求参数读取方式。如果你发现自己知道的不到6种,那么赶紧来查漏补缺一下。如果你知道的不止...
"Spring Boot实战"试读 ··· 本章内容 Spring Boot简化Spring应用程序开发 Spring Boot的基本特性 Spring Boot工作区的设置 Spring Framework已有十余年的历史了,已成为Java应用程序开发框架的事实标准。在如此悠久的历史背景下,有人可能会认为Spring放慢了脚步,躺在了自己的荣誉簿上...
首先,我们需要在我们的Spring Boot项目中添加Elasticsearch的依赖。在pom.xml文件中添加以下代码: AI检测代码解析 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-elasticsearch</artifactId></dependency> 1.
SpringBoot_Vue3 《Hello World》项目入门教程 1. 前言 前后端分离模式,可以让后端和前端开发人员致力于自己擅长的领域,且可以让前端和后端业务逻辑高度解耦合。本文从一个简单的案例入手,讲解使用spring boot和vue3如何实现前后端的分离。 前后端分离有2种模式:...